Here are a 10 questions that are on the printable sentence activities below, where students choose from a list of letter J words (jeans, juror, joint, jaded, judge, jelly, jolly, jewel, joust, juice and places them in the correct sentence:
- The doctor recommended a brace to support her injured ________.
- The children were ________ and full of laughter during the party.
- The knights learned how to ________ as part of their daily preparation for tournaments.
- The ________ carefully considered the evidence before making a ruling.
- The fresh orange ________ was a perfect complement to the breakfast.
- After years of working in the same job, he had become ________ and no longer found joy in his work.
- The diamond was a beautiful ________ that sparkled in the light.
- She wore her favorite pair of ________ and a comfortable t-shirt for the long car ride.
- The peanut butter and ________ sandwich was a classic lunchtime favorite.
- The ________ listened to the testimony and evidence presented during the trial before reaching a verdict.
